Transaction 31f5341d09b4c6df92164194049098699f0d80acd8bee41dec4d77a127f7ecff

69 Input
2 Outputs
  • 31f5341d09b4c6df92164194049098699f0d80acd8bee41dec4d77a127f7ecff:0
  • value  792947
    address  14CC6CyLWGnEkpzjC1KG9VnyzEnNsWuxW5
  • 31f5341d09b4c6df92164194049098699f0d80acd8bee41dec4d77a127f7ecff:1
  • value  100000000
    address  17262J1AXJpnVi13PMJXKSfSKztwz8RbV